Why Choose Self-Serve Fuel?
Self-serve fuel stations typically offer savings of $0.30-$1.00+ per gallon compared to full-service. For a 50-gallon fill-up, that's $15-$50 in savings. Self-serve is available 24/7 at many locations, making it convenient for early departures or late arrivals. Most self-serve pumps accept major credit cards and aviation fuel cards.
